Digital Marketing Market Growth and Size
The digital marketing growth trajectory shows no signs of slowing down. The global digital marketing market reached $598.58 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 9.20% between 2025 and 2034, reaching approximately $1,443.27 billion by 2034.

Global digital ad spending is steadily increasing and is expected to hit $734.6 billion by 2025. According to recent projections, digital ad spend will increase by 10.1% in 2025, reaching over $765 billion.

Digital Marketing ROI and Performance Metrics

Marketing ROI remains a critical concern for businesses investing in digital channels. For every dollar invested in digital marketing, businesses witness an average return of $5. However, digital marketing channels show varying performance levels:
ROI by Marketing Channel:
Channel | Time to Break Even | ROAS (3-year average) | ROI (3-year average) |
---|---|---|---|
SEO | 9 months | 9.10 | 748% |
Email Marketing | 7 months | 3.50 | 261% |
Webinars | 9 months | 4.95 | 430% |
SEM/PPC | 4 months | 1.55 | 36% |
Facebook Ads | 3 months | 1.80 | 87% |
Email marketing demonstrates exceptional performance with an ROI of $36 for every $1 spent, representing a 3,600% return. Search engine optimization also shows strong returns, with businesses receiving $22 for every dollar invested in SEO.
Mobile Marketing Statistics
Mobile marketing continues to dominate digital advertising landscapes. Mobile advertising is projected to make up 70% of total ad spend by 2028. The shift toward mobile-first strategies reflects changing consumer behavior patterns.

By 2026, smartphones will drive 69% of total ad spending, making mobile optimization essential for digital marketing success.

Email Marketing Statistics
Email marketing statistics continue to demonstrate the channel's effectiveness as a cornerstone of digital marketing strategies. With 4.37 billion people sending 347.3 billion emails daily, email remains a critical communication channel.

Email automation is increasingly popular, with 65% of marketers using automated email campaigns. The conversion rate increases by 56% when emails include emojis in subject lines.

Content Marketing Trends and Statistics
Content marketing statistics highlight the growing importance of valuable, relevant content in digital strategies. Nearly 80% of successful content marketers spend more than 10% of their total marketing budgets on content.
Short-form videos lead content performance with 31% ROI, followed by images at 22% and blog posts at 15%. Content marketing strategies face several challenges:
Content Marketing Challenges | Share of Votes |
---|---|
Attracting Quality Leads | 45% |
Creating More Content Faster | 38% |
Generating Content Ideas | 35% |
Generating Enough Traffic | 35% |
Video marketing continues to dominate, with 86% of businesses using video as a marketing tool and 92% of marketers considering it important.
Artificial Intelligence in Digital Marketing
Marketing automation and AI adoption are transforming digital marketing approaches. In an Insider Intelligence survey, 76% of marketers use AI for basic content creation and copywriting.

Gartner forecasts that 30% of outgoing marketing messages from large businesses will be AI-generated by 2025
